- Patent Title: Execution of work units in a heterogeneous computing environment
-
Application No.: US13014123Application Date: 2011-01-26
-
Publication No.: US08448176B2Publication Date: 2013-05-21
- Inventor: Ivan Jellinek , Alberto Poggesi , Anthony C. Sumrall , Thomas A. Thackrey
- Applicant: Ivan Jellinek , Alberto Poggesi , Anthony C. Sumrall , Thomas A. Thackrey
- Applicant Address: US NY Armonk
- Assignee: International Business Machines Corporation
- Current Assignee: International Business Machines Corporation
- Current Assignee Address: US NY Armonk
- Agency: Heslin Rothenberg Farley & Mesiti P.C.
- Agent Steven Chiu, Esq.; Blanche E. Schiller, Esq.
- Main IPC: G06F9/46
- IPC: G06F9/46

Abstract:
Work units are transparently offloaded from a main processor to offload processing systems for execution. For a particular work unit, a suitable offload processing system is selected to execute the work unit. This includes determining the requirements of the work unit, including, for instance, the hardware and software requirements; matching those requirements against a set of offload processing systems with an arbitrary set of available resources; and determining if a suitable offload processing system is available. If a suitable offload processing system is available, the work unit is scheduled to execute on that offload processing system with no changes to the work unit itself. Otherwise, the work unit may execute on the main processor or wait to be executed on an offload processing system.
Public/Granted literature
- US08566831B2 Execution of work units in a heterogeneous computing environment Public/Granted day:2013-10-22
Information query